How often should you clean a pellet grill?

You should give your grill a deep clean roughly every 50 hours of cooking. If you don’t cook on your pellet grill very often (you should fix that), you may only need to deep clean your grill once every several months.

How often should I clean my pit boss pellet grill?

How Often Should I Clean My Pellet Grill? A good rule of thumb: after every bag of pellets. You can burn through an entire bag after 8-10 uses if you’re grilling, or after 1-2 sessions if you’re doing some longer, all day smoking.

How often should you clean your smoker?

As a general rule, you should clean your smoker every two or three cooks, but it depends on the type of smoker. Charcoal smokers are messy and should be cleaned regularly, but electric, gas and pellet smokers are much cleaner and may only need a full clean every four or five cooks.

How often do I have to clean my Traeger grill?

We recommend cleaning the grill after every 2-3 cooks. However, you may need to clean it out more often when cooking greasier foods or after a long cook.

Can you leave pellets in hopper?

‘Leaving unused pellets in your hopper can cause them to rot since they will be exposed to the elements of your outdoor environment….Emptying your hopper after each cook and storing the leftover pellets in a secure device like sealed bucket can ensure your pellets last as long as possible.

Can a pellet grill catch on fire?

Pellet grills like Traeger can catch fire, caused either by too many pellets in the firepot or too much grease on the drip tray. It’s important to keep your pellets dry as moisture can cause them to clump and feed improperly into the auger and firepot.

How do you clean ashes from a pellet grill?

The burn pot will often have a lot of ash build-up and debris that you will need to remove. The simplest way to clean your pellet smoker’s burn pot is with a vacuum cleaner or ash vac. Use the hose to suck out all the ash and then wipe away any remaining ash or soot using a clean rag.

Do you need to season a pellet grill?

Like any pellet smoker, your grill needs to be seasoned before you can use it. The whole process roughly takes about an hour to complete and you’ll need enough wood pellets to run the grill on HIGH for at least 45 minutes.

Should you ever clean the inside of your smoker?

You may need to clean out the smoker completely from time to time and re-season it, but it is critical for you to maintain the oily, smoky surface over the metal to prevent rusting. … Though many users neglect this duty, a smoker should be cleaned free of ashes and grease deposits after every use.

How do I keep my smoker clean?

Using warm, soapy water, gently scrub the interior surfaces of the smoker with a sponge or a plastic bristle brush. Do not use metal. Wipe it dry. If using a bristle brush, make sure no loose bristles remain on any of the cooking surfaces prior to cooking.

Should you clean the inside of an electric smoker?

You do need to keep your smoker tidy and clear of any food deposits. Scoop out anything that’s loose but don’t feel that you have to go at it with a scraper and scrape down to the metal. Dependent on the wood that you have used you may get some tar deposits and these should be removed too.

Can you leave a pellet grill outside?

Pellet Grill Smokers can be left outside in mild climates, however, in winter months they should be stored in a garage. Pellet Grill Smokers are not designed for exposed sun or rain. They should always be in a covered roof area.

How do you deep clean a Traeger?

How To Clean A Traeger

  1. Make sure grill is cool and unplugged.
  2. Open Pellet hopper lid, place 5 gallon bucket under the back pellet door and drain pellets into a bucket. …
  3. Open Traeger lid and using a grill brush scrub the top of the grates. …
  4. Remove the grates and set aside.
  5. Asses the amount of soot or particulate on the inside of the barrel.
